#ifndef INCLUDED_XMBSTORAGE
#define INCLUDED_XMBSTORAGE
#include "scriptinterface/ScriptForward.h"
#include <memory>
typedef struct _xmlDoc xmlDoc;
typedef xmlDoc* xmlDocPtr;
struct IVFS;
typedef std::shared_ptr<IVFS> PIVFS;
class Path;
typedef Path VfsPath;
/**
* Storage for XMBData
*/
class XMBStorage
{
public:
// File headers, to make sure it doesn't try loading anything other than an XMB
static const char* HeaderMagicStr;
static const char* UnfinishedHeaderMagicStr;
static const u32 XMBVersion;
XMBStorage() = default;
/**
* Read an XMB file on disk.
*/
bool ReadFromFile(const PIVFS& vfs, const VfsPath& filename);
/**
* Parse an XML document into XMB.
*
* Main limitations:
* - Can't correctly handle mixed text/elements inside elements -
* "<div> <b> Text </b> </div>" and "<div> Te<b/>xt </div>" are
* considered identical.
*/
bool LoadXMLDoc(const xmlDocPtr doc);
/**
* Parse a Javascript value into XMB.
* The syntax is similar to ParamNode, but supports multiple children with the same name, to match XML.
* You need to pass the name of the root object, as unlike XML this cannot be recovered from the value.
* The following JS object:
* {
* "a": 5,
* "b": "test",
* "x": {
* // Like ParamNode, _string is used for the value.
* "_string": "value",
* // Like ParamNode, attributes are prefixed with @.
* "@param": "something",
* "y": 3
* },
* // Every array item is parsed as a child.
* "object": [
* "a",
* "b",
* { "_string": "c" },
* { "child": "value" },
* ],
* // Same but without the array.
* "child@0@": 1,
* "child@1@": 2
* }
* will parse like the following XML:
* <a>5
* <b>test</b>
* <x param="something">value
* <y>3</y>
* </x>
* <object>a</object>
* <object>b</object>
* <object>c</object>
* <object><child>value</child></object>
* <child>1</child>
* <child>2</child>
* </a>
* See also tests for some other examples.
*/
bool LoadJSValue(const ScriptInterface& scriptInterface, JS::HandleValue value, const std::string& rootName);
std::shared_ptr<u8> m_Buffer;
size_t m_Size = 0;
};
#endif // INCLUDED_XMBSTORAGE
